More About Western State Bank in Devils Lake

Devils Lake, North Dakota, is a city steeped in history, serving as the county seat of Ramsey County and home to a population of 7,192 as of the 2020 census. The city, named after the nearby body of water, has seen significant growth and development since its establishment in the late 19th century. Within this evolving landscape, Western State Bank has emerged as a notable institution, contributing to the local economy and community fabric.

With a legacy spanning over a century, Western State Bank provides a range of banking services that cater to both personal and business customers. Its presence in Devils Lake reflects the bank's commitment to serving the financial needs of the community, fostering economic growth, and supporting local initiatives. As a member of the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) and an Equal Housing Lender, the bank plays a vital role in promoting financial stability and accessibility for residents.
